The NIV Zondervan Study Bible, featuring Dr. D.A. Carson as general editor, is built on the truth of Scripture and centered on the gospel message. In an ambitious and comprehensive undertaking, Dr. Carson, along with a team of over 60 contributors from a wide range of evangelical denominations and perspectives, crafted all-new study notes and other study tools to present a biblical theology of God’s special revelation in the Scriptures.

D.A. Carson, General Editor, is Research Professor of New Testament at Trinity Evangelical Divinity School in Deerfield, Illinois. He is the president and a founding member of The Gospel Coalition, an influential network of evangelical pastors and churches. Carson has served as assistant pastor and pastor and has done itinerant ministry around the world. He is a sought-after preacher, author, and an active guest lecturer in academic and church settings worldwide. Carson received a Master of Divinity from Central Baptist Seminary in Toronto and the Doctor of Philosophy in New Testament from the University of Cambridge He has written or edited nearly 60 books, many of which have been translated into other languages
Executive Committee: Dr. T. Desmond Alexander, Dr. Richard Hess, Dr. Douglas J. Moo, and Dr. Andrew David Naselli.
